1. Overview

The Imperial College London President’s PhD Scholarships 2027-28 is one of the most competitive and prestigious doctoral funding schemes in the world. Imperial offers 50 scholarships annually to outstanding students who show exceptional academic performance and research potential.

Unlike many UK scholarships, there are NO nationality restrictions and it covers ALL research areas at Imperial. Scholars choose their own research project with support from a supervisor.

2. What the Scholarship Covers (2027-28 Rates)

BenefitAmount / Details
Tuition FeesFULLY FUNDED – Home & Overseas fees covered
Living Stipend£27,036 per year (2027-28 rate) – tax free
Consumables / Research Fund£2,000 per year for first 3 years
Duration3.5 years (42 months)
Cohort BenefitsAccess to Early Career Researcher Institute, bespoke events, professional development
Additional SupportGraduate School skills training, disability & international student support
💡 Total Estimated Value: Over £150,000+ for overseas students (tuition ~£27k/year + stipend + research costs)

3. Eligibility Criteria

Academic Criteria (HIGHER than usual):

  • Must have or expected First Class or equivalent in Undergraduate or Integrated Masters OR
  • If you don’t have First Class undergrad, you MUST have or expect Distinction in standalone Masters degree
  • Single undergraduate degree holders must have First Class

Other Criteria:

  • Nationality: ALL nationalities eligible – UK and worldwide
  • Study Mode: Full-time and Part-time both eligible
  • New Applicants ONLY: Current Imperial PhD students NOT eligible
  • Alternate Pathways: Imperial accepts non-traditional pathways with exceptional research potential and documented extenuating circumstances
  • Supervisor: You MUST have contacted a supervisor who agreed to supervise you BEFORE applying

4. Eligible Fields

All PhD programmes offered at Imperial College London including:

  • Engineering (Civil, Mechanical, Electrical, Chemical, Bioengineering etc.)
  • Natural Sciences (Physics, Chemistry, Maths, Life Sciences)
  • Medicine & Health
  • Business School (research-led)
  • Interdisciplinary & AI, Climate, Sustainable Futures

5. Required Documents Checklist

DocumentSpecification
Personal Statement (2 pages)Page 1: Motivations for Imperial + Scholarship, Page 2: Research Proposal Summary
Detailed Research ProposalIf department requires – attach under ‘Research Proposal’ tab
Academic TranscriptsUndergrad & Masters, with grading scale
Degree CertificatesOr expected award letter
CV / ResumeInclude research experience, publications, awards
Two Academic RefereesNOT your proposed supervisor. Use tutors, thesis supervisors. Share inclusive reference guidance.
English ProficiencyIELTS/TOEFL if required by department (usually IELTS 6.5-7.0)

6. Step-by-Step Application Process (How to Apply)

There is NO separate scholarship form. You apply for PhD admission and select President’s Scholarship option.

  1. Find Supervisor (Most Important – Start NOW): Browse Imperial doctoral courses: Find a Supervisor. Email 3-5 professors with your CV + brief research idea. Subject: “Prospective President’s PhD Scholar – [Your Topic]”. Check Unavailable Supervisors List – supervisors can only have ONE President’s scholar at a time.
  2. Secure Supervisor Agreement: Get email confirmation that they will supervise you if you get funding.
  3. Create Account on Imperial Admissions Portal: https://apply.imperial.ac.uk/
  4. Complete Online Application: Choose your PhD programme, start date between 1 Aug 2027 and 1 Nov 2027.
  5. In Funding Section: Tick “President’s PhD Scholarship” in Additional Questions tab.
  6. Upload 2-Page Personal Statement: Use our free sample below as template.
  7. Add Two Referees: Enter their institutional emails. Notify them early.
  8. Submit BEFORE Deadline: Apply by 2 Nov 2026 (first round best chance), 11 Jan 2027, or 1 Mar 2027 at 23:59 UK time.
  9. Department Review: If shortlisted, you may be invited for interview.
  10. Final Decision: By College Selection Panel (Vice-Provost, Graduate School Director, Faculty Vice-Deans). Not selected? You remain considered for standard PhD.

8. Deadlines & When You’ll Hear

Apply By (23:59 UK time)Decision ByStrategy
2 November 202631 January 2027BEST CHANCE – Most scholarships awarded here
11 January 202715 April 2027Second largest round
1 March 202731 May 2027Final round – very competitive

Earliest start: 1 August 2027 | Latest start: 1 November 2027

9. Expert Tips to Win (From Past Scholars)

  • Contact supervisor 3-4 months before deadline. Don’t mass email. Read 2 papers of each professor.
  • Show, don’t tell research potential: Papers, GitHub, patents, conference talks > just grades.
  • Your proposal must be YOURS: Panel detects generic AI proposals. Add your unique angle from your home country experience.
  • Get strong referees: One who can comment on research, one on academic excellence. Give them CV + proposal + Imperial referee guidance link.
  • Apply in Round 1: Departments forward best candidates early. 60% offers made in first round.
  • Address Alternate Pathways if relevant: If you had career break, caring duties, first-gen – use that section.

10. FAQs

Q: Can Nigerians / Indians / Africans apply?
A: Yes! No nationality restriction. Imperial explicitly welcomes worldwide applicants.

Q: Do I need IELTS before applying?
A: No, you can apply without, but you must meet department English requirement before enrolment if offered.

Q: Is there age limit?
A: No age limit.

Q: Can I apply for multiple departments?
A: You can submit multiple PhD applications but each needs separate supervisor agreement.

Q: Does scholarship cover family visa?
A: Stipend is generous for UK living. Dependent visas are separate UKVI process, not funded.
